WAFCON: Asisat Oshoala plays down Bayana Bayana hype.

Super Falcons forward Asisat Oshoala has expressed optimism Nigeria will defeat South Africa’s Bayana Bayana when both teams meet on 4th July 2022 in the Group C opener of the ongoing WAFCON.

 

Bayana Bayana are on paper one of the most improved female sides in Africa and have risen to challenge the Super Falcons who were at a time undisputed queens of African Football.

 

In an interview with NFF TV ahead of Monday’s game the Fc Barcelona Fermini forward played down the statistics of South Africa winning two of the last three meetings between both sides the most recent a 2-4 win in Lagos last year.

 

Oshoala said, ” We have a very good group, an opportunity to qualify for the next round but sometimes football isn’t about what you see alone.

” A lot of people have talked about South Africa . Of course they are a very good side but this isn’t about old glory or past records.

” Many expected us to win (the last meeting in Lagos) but we lost to them and now people are saying they are the best side let’s see. It’s okay for people to talk.

” We just have to look at ourselves and approach the game with the right mentality. ” The Multiple time CAF Womens player of the year award winner concluded.

 

Nigeria will be gunning for a Ninth WAFCON title in  Morroco and victory over the South African ladies on Monday will set the tone.

 

Hosts Morroco on Saturday defeated Burkina Faso 1-0 in the opening game of the Women’s Africa Cup of Nations .
